Responsibilities & Context: Community Development Centre –CODEC is a leading development organization have been working in the coastal area of Bangladesh since 1985. CODEC Community Development Centre (CODEC) is implementing “Southeast Flood response ““ project in Noakhali district funded by WFP. At present CODEC is implementing ''Cash for Work’’ supported by WFP in Noakhali district.T
The project initially run up to 15 May 2025.
Responsibilities:
- Develop and deliver comprehensive training programs for project beneficiaries on various livelihood activities.
- Conduct market assessments to identify small income generation opportunities and establish sustainable market linkages for project beneficiaries.
- Facilitate connections between root level target group, and other market players to enhance market access.
-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of training programs and market linkage activities, providing actionable recommendations for improvement.
- Prepare detailed reports on training outcomes, market opportunities, and beneficiary progress, focusing on sustainability and scalability.
- Collaborate with local authorities, NGOs, and private sector partners to enhance market access and promote sustainable livelihood practices.
- Other related activities will be assigned by the Project Coordinator.
- Should abide by the Inter-Agency Standing Committee (IASC)'s six core principles on Protection from Sexual Exploitation and Abuse (PSEA) policy.
- Ensure the safety of team members (with respect to Prevention of sexual exploitation and abuse - PSEA) from any harm, abuse, neglect, harassment, and exploitation to achieve the program's goals of safeguarding implementation.
- Act as a key source of support, guidance, and expertise on safeguarding to establish a safe working environment.
